Costs of Resin Bound Gravel for Active Travel

The average cost of resin bound gravel for active travel is between £50-£70 per metre square.

The cost of resin-bound gravel for active travel paths can vary widely depending on several factors, including the size of the project, the quality of materials, labour costs in your area, and any site-specific requirements. Here are some cost factors to consider:

  • Surface Area: The size of the area you want to cover with resin-bound gravel is a significant factor. The larger the area, the more materials and labour will be required, which will increase the cost.

  • Gravel Type: The type and quality of the gravel used can affect the cost. Higher-quality and more decorative gravel options may be more expensive.

  • Preparation Work: The condition of the existing surface and the amount of preparation work required can impact costs. If the site needs extensive excavation, grading, or drainage improvements, it will add to the overall cost.

  • Edging and Borders: Installing edging or borders around the path can add to the cost but can also enhance the appearance and durability of the surface.

  • Access: The ease of access to the project site can influence costs. Difficult-to-reach areas may require special equipment or more labour, increasing expenses.

  • Labour Costs: Labour costs can vary significantly by location. Highly skilled labour may cost more but can ensure a quality installation.

  • Resin Type: The type and quality of the resin used can affect costs. Some resins are more expensive but offer better durability and UV resistance.

  • Site-specific Factors: Unique site requirements, such as unusual shapes, intricate designs, or the need to work around existing structures, can impact costs.

  • Maintenance: Consider long-term maintenance costs when budgeting for resin-bound gravel. While it's a low-maintenance option compared to some alternatives, periodic cleaning and resealing may be necessary.

Resin Bound System Uses for Active Travel Beaconsfield

Resin bound systems, often referred to as resin bound gravel or resin-bound paving, are versatile and can be used for various active travel applications.

Active travel typically involves walking, cycling, or other non-motorised forms of transportation. Here are some common uses of resin-bound systems for active travel:

  • Footpaths and Walkways: Resin-bound surfaces are an excellent choice for footpaths and walkways in parks, public spaces, and pedestrian zones. They provide a comfortable, slip-resistant, and durable surface for pedestrians, making it safer and more pleasant to walk.

  • Cycle Paths: Resin-bound systems can be used to create dedicated cycle paths and bike lanes. These surfaces are smooth, low-maintenance, and provide good traction for cyclists.

  • Shared Use Paths: In areas where pedestrians and cyclists share the same space, resin-bound surfaces can be used to create shared use paths. The even surface benefits both walkers and cyclists.

  • Public Spaces: Resin-bound systems can be used in public spaces to create attractive and pedestrian-friendly surfaces. These areas often serve as gathering places for people who are actively travelling on foot.

  • Park Trails: Resin-bound paths can be installed in parks and natural areas to create trails for walking, jogging, or hiking. These paths are often more stable than traditional gravel paths and provide a more comfortable walking experience.

  • Schools: Resin-bound systems are used in school campuses to create safe and durable pathways for students and staff. They can connect various buildings and facilities on the campus.

  • Tourist Attractions: Resin-bound surfaces are commonly used in and around tourist attractions, such as botanical gardens, historical sites, and recreational areas, to provide visitors with accessible and attractive paths.

  • Commercial and Residential Developments: Resin-bound systems can be used in housing developments, shopping centres, and business districts to create pedestrian-friendly walkways, courtyards, and outdoor seating areas.

  • Accessibility Ramps: Resin-bound surfaces are suitable for constructing accessible ramps and paths.

  • Urban Areas: In urban renewal projects, resin-bound systems can be used to transform underutilised spaces into vibrant pedestrian zones, encouraging active travel and community engagement.

Benefits of Resin Bound Gravel for Active Travel Routes

Resin bound gravel surfaces offer several benefits for active travel routes, making them a popular choice for footpaths, cycle paths, and other pedestrian and cyclist-friendly applications. Here are some of the key advantages:

  • Safety: Resin-bound gravel surfaces provide a safe and slip-resistant walking and cycling environment. The bound gravel texture offers good traction, reducing the risk of slips and falls, especially in wet conditions.

  • Comfort: These surfaces are comfortable to walk or cycle on, offering a smooth and stable surface that minimizes the impact on joints, making them suitable for people of all ages.

  • Durability: Resin-bound systems are highly durable and can withstand heavy foot and bike traffic. They are resistant to wear and erosion, which makes them a long-lasting option for active travel routes.

  • Low Maintenance: Resin-bound gravel requires minimal maintenance. Regular sweeping and occasional power washing are typically sufficient to keep the surface clean and in good condition. This low maintenance requirement makes it cost-effective over time.

  • Permeability: Resin bound surfaces are permeable, allowing rainwater to pass through and into the ground below. This helps to prevent puddling and surface water runoff, reducing the risk of flooding and ensuring that the path remains usable even during and after heavy rain.

  • Customisation: Resin bound systems offer a wide range of design possibilities. They can be customised with various colours, patterns, and even logos or markings, making it possible to create visually appealing and distinctive active travel routes.

  • Accessibility: Resin bound gravel can be installed to meet accessibility standards. It can create smooth, even surfaces that are wheelchair-friendly and suitable for people with mobility challenges.

  • UV Stability: High-quality resins used in these systems are UV stable, meaning they won't fade or degrade when exposed to sunlight for extended periods. This ensures that the surface maintains its appearance and performance over time.

  • Quick Installation: Resin bound systems can often be installed relatively quickly, minimizing disruption to the area where the active travel route is being created or renovated.

  • Eco-Friendly: The use of recycled materials in some resin bound gravel systems can contribute to sustainability goals. Additionally, the permeable nature of the surface can help with groundwater recharge and reduce the heat island effect in urban areas.

  • Versatility: Resin-bound gravel can be applied over various existing surfaces, including concrete, asphalt, and compacted soil, making it a versatile choice for retrofitting existing paths or creating new ones.

Overall, resin bound gravel is a versatile and practical choice for creating safe, attractive, and long-lasting active travel routes that cater to the needs of pedestrians and cyclists while offering a range of benefits for both users and the environment.

What is Resin Bound Gravel?

Resin bound gravel is a porous base using a range of natural aggregates, such as real stones, marble, gravel and glass.

These loose stones are part of a scatter system that creates natural-looking resin bound systems, effectively solidifying loose gravel into solid outdoor surfaces.

Since the loose gravel is carefully bonded and mixed into the surface, resin bound gravel in Beaconsfield provides a smooth finish and is very damage resistant.

The resulting surface has many applications while retaining an aesthetically pleasing appearance.
